GENERAL DESCRIPTION:
This dataset contains the approved acquisition boundaries of the National Wildlife Refuges, National Fish Hatcheries and USFWS administrative sites in Florida.

FEATURE ATTRIBUTE TABLES CODES AND VALUES:

Item
Item Description
OBJECTID Internal feature number.

IFWSNO The administrative number assigned to each refuge.

LIT The three letter abbreviation of the full refuge name.

ORGCODE Five digit organization code that uniquely identifies a Service organization that is staffed and funded.

ORGNAME The full, official name of the refuge.

MAILADD1 First line of the mailing address for the station

MAILADD2 Second line, if needed, of the mailing address for the station

MAILCITY City in the mailing address for the station

MAILSTATE Two letter state abbreviation from the official postal codes for the mailing address for the station

MAILZIP Five Digit postal code for the mailing address for the station

MAILZIP4 Additional 4 digit code that can be added to the zip code of the mailing address for the station

PHONE 3 digit area code and station phone number

DESCRIPT Refuge Name

FGDLAQDATE Data Acquisition Date

AUTOID Internal Feature ID (FID + 1)

SHAPE Feature geometry.

SHAPE.AREA Area in meters

SHAPE.LEN Perimeter in meters

Refuge boundary data were compiled for resource applications. It is inappropriate 
to use this data in legal situations, or other applications where spatial error cannot 
exceed the USGS 7.5' mapping standards.

The boundaries included in this coverage will 
be updated as more information is received. 
Please check the dates on the web page for 
update information.

The intended application of the data is to serve as a spatial reference of facility 
boundaries for other data layers in GIS and mapping applications. It is specifically 
not intended to be used as a land survey or representation of land for conveyance 
or tax purposes. This data set in particular has been generalized even more than 
the individual refuges data sets and is intended solely as an overview or locator 
map.

A note about data scale: 

Scale is an important factor in data usage.  Certain scale datasets
are not suitable for some project, analysis, or modeling purposes.
Please be sure you are using the best available data. 

1:24000 scale datasets are recommended for projects that are at the
county level.
1:24000 data should NOT be used for high accuracy base mapping such
as property parcel boundaries.
1:100000 scale datasets are recommended for projects that are at the
multi-county or regional level.
1:125000 scale datasets are recommended for projects that are at the
regional or state level or larger.

Vector datasets with no defined scale or accuracy should be
considered suspect. Make sure you are familiar with your data
before using it for projects or analysis. Every effort has been

DATA LINEAGE SUMMARY:
*Downloaded the Region 4 Refuge boundaries from 
http://gis.sds.fws.gov/website/fwsbndry/CustomHelp.htm.  

*The data was reprojected to the Albers Conical Equal Area Projection.  
*All boundaries that intersected Florida were selected and exported as a layer.  
*All fields were upcased.  
*Created a PHONE field and combined the AREACODE field and the seven digit 
TELEPHONE field.  Deleted the AREACODE and TELEPHONE fields in favor of 
the combined 10 digit phone number in the PHONE field.  
*A DESCRIPT field was added and filled with ORGNAME.
*A FGDLAQDATE was added based on date downloaded from source.
*An AUTOID field was added and filled with [FID] +1.  

There were 475 features in the existing nwrfla dataset on FGDL, there are 343 
features in the Region_4_NWR_Approved_Aq_Boundaries that were 
downloaded.  The difference was due to the fact that the existing layer contained 
property specific information, i.e. outparcels that were part of the wildlife refuges.  
The new layer contains only the approved boundary of the refuges.
